"Cheorwon Peace Observatory" (n.d) is located at Junggang-ri, Dongsong-eup, South Korea. The Observatory is three stories high with a basement and was opened in November 2007. The observatory's first floor is the exhibition hall and the second floor is an observatory.

Cheorwon County was a historical county of Korea. In 1895, Cheorwon County reorganized into Chuncheon , [ 1 ] then reorganized into Gangwon Province the following year. [ 2 ] In 1945, it was reorganized by the Soviet Civil Administration . [ 3 ]

Griffith Observatory is an observatory in Los Angeles, California, on the south-facing slope of Mount Hollywood in Griffith Park.It commands a view of the Los Angeles Basin including Downtown Los Angeles to the southeast, Hollywood to the south, and the Pacific Ocean to the southwest.
